Sophie

Sophie

distrib > Mandriva > 9.1 > i586 > by-pkgid > f1098342ec4a2b28475e34123ce17201 > files > 1043

howto-html-it-9.1-0.5mdk.noarch.rpm

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2 Final//EN">
<HTML>
<HEAD>
 <META NAME="GENERATOR" CONTENT="SGML-Tools 1.0.9">
 <TITLE>SMB HOWTO: Installazione</TITLE>
 <LINK HREF="SMB-HOWTO-5.html" REL=next>
 <LINK HREF="SMB-HOWTO-3.html" REL=previous>
 <LINK HREF="SMB-HOWTO.html#toc4" REL=contents>
</HEAD>
<BODY>
<A HREF="SMB-HOWTO-5.html">Avanti</A>
<A HREF="SMB-HOWTO-3.html">Indietro</A>
<A HREF="SMB-HOWTO.html#toc4">Indice</A>
<HR>
<H2><A NAME="s4">4. Installazione</A></H2>

<P>Per prima cosa, al fine di poter usare Samba sulle proprie macchine
&egrave; necessario utilizzare un singolo segmento LAN ethernet ed usare il
protocollo TCP/IP.  Samba non funzioner&agrave; con altri protocolli di rete.
Generalmente &egrave; facile soddisfare questa richiesta, dal momento che
Linux e Windows 95/98/NT sono distribuiti con il TCP/IP.
Tuttavia, se si usa Windows 3.x &egrave; necessario aggiungere il supporto
TCP/IP.  Una delle domande poste pi&ugrave; di frequente &egrave; perch&eacute; Samba
``non funziona'' con sistemi Windows senza il protocollo TCP/IP.
<P>Per installare TCP/IP con Windows 95/98, si deve selezionare
Pannello di controllo | Rete, aggiungere e configurare Microsoft
TCP/IP.  Con Windows NT, si selezioni Pannello di Controllo | Rete |
Protocolli.
<P>Per prelevare l'ultima versione di <B>Samba</B> si deve selezionare 
il mirror pi&ugrave; vicino, dalla lista disponibile presso:
<P>
<A HREF="ftp://ftp.samba.org/">ftp://ftp.samba.org/</A><P>Nella maggior parte dei casi, le distribuzioni Linux dispongono
gi&agrave; dei pacchetti di una versione recente di Samba.
<P>Il pacchetto <B>Samba</B> richiede due demoni.  Tipicamente sono installati 
in <CODE>/usr/sbin</CODE> ed eseguiti o in fase di avvio dagli <I>script di 
inizializzazione</I> del sistema o da <B>inetd</B>.  Script di esempio sono 
elencati in 
<A HREF="SMB-HOWTO-5.html#sec-daemons">Eseguire i demoni</A>.
<P>
<HR>
<PRE>
    smbd (Il demone SMB)
    nmbd (Fornisce supporto di NetBIOS nameserver per i client)
</PRE>
<HR>
<P>Si noti che il servizio dei nomi fornito dal demone nmbd &egrave; differente dal
servizio fornito da Domain Name Service (DNS).  Il servizio di nomi
NetBIOS usato da SMB &egrave; ``stile-Windows''.  In altre parole, avere
un DNS attivo, non ha nulla a che vedere con la possibilit&agrave; di Samba di
risolvere i nomi dei computer.
<P>Di solito (la posizione &egrave; opzionale) i seguenti programmi di <B>Samba</B> 
sono installati in <CODE>/usr/bin</CODE> oppure <CODE>/usr/local/samba/bin</CODE>:
<P>
<DL>
<DT><B>smbclient</B><DD><P>Client SMB per macchine UNIX
<P>
<DT><B>smbprint</B><DD><P>script per usare la stampante di un host SMB
<P>
<DT><B>smbprint.sysv</B><DD><P>Come <CODE>smbprint</CODE> per macchine con UNIX SVR4
<P>
<DT><B>smbstatus</B><DD><P>Elenca le connessioni SMB correnti per il computer locale
<P>
<DT><B>smbrun</B><DD><P>Facilita esecuzioni di applicazioni su un host SMB
</DL>
<P>La distribuzione in formato binario per il supporto del file system
smbfs, &egrave; discussa successivamente in questo documento.
<P>Inoltre, &egrave; incluso in questo HOWTO uno script chiamato 
<A HREF="SMB-HOWTO-10.html#smbprint">print</A>, da usare come interfaccia per 
<CODE>smbprint</CODE>.
<P>Il pacchetto <B>Samba</B> &egrave; semplice da installare.  Per prima cosa &egrave; 
necessario recuperare il sorgente dal sito elencato precedentemente e 
leggere il file <CODE>README</CODE> della distribuzione.  C'&egrave; anche un 
file chiamato <CODE>docs/INSTALL.txt</CODE> che fornisce istruzioni 
passo-a-passo.
<P>Seguendo l'installazione, si pongono i demoni in <CODE>/usr/sbin</CODE> ed i 
programmi in <CODE>/usr/bin</CODE>.  Le pagine del manuale in 
<CODE>/usr/local/man</CODE>.
<P>Compilando il pacchetto <B>Samba</B>, si specifica nel <CODE>Makefile</CODE> la 
locazione del file di configurazione <CODE>smb.conf</CODE>, generalmente 
<CODE>/etc</CODE>, ma pu&ograve; essere una qualsiasi.  Per questo documento si 
suppone che tale file di configurazione sia <CODE>/etc/smb.conf</CODE>; 
altri file di configurazione: <CODE>/var/log/samba-log.%m</CODE> e 
<I>lock directory</I> <CODE>/var/lock/samba</CODE>.
<P>Si installi il file di configurazione, <CODE>smb.conf</CODE>. Nella directory
dove si &egrave; compilato Samba &egrave; presente una sottodirectory
<CODE>examples/simple</CODE> e si legga il file README.  Si copi il file 
<CODE>smb.conf</CODE> in <CODE>/etc</CODE>.  ATTENZIONE!  Se si ha una
distribuzione Linux con gi&agrave; Samba installato, potrebbe gi&agrave; essere presente
un file di configurazione in <CODE>/etc</CODE>, sarebbe meglio iniziare con
quello.
<P>Se non si desidera avere il file di configurazione in <CODE>/etc</CODE>, 
pu&ograve; essere messo in una qualsiasi posizione ed eventualmente collegato con 
un <I>link</I> simbolico in <CODE>/etc</CODE>:
<P>
<HR>
<PRE>
    ln -s /percorso/di/smb.conf /etc/smb.conf
</PRE>
<HR>
<P>
<HR>
<A HREF="SMB-HOWTO-5.html">Avanti</A>
<A HREF="SMB-HOWTO-3.html">Indietro</A>
<A HREF="SMB-HOWTO.html#toc4">Indice</A>
</BODY>
</HTML>